**Question:** What are some of the best design hotels for solo travelers?
**Answer:** Some of the best design hotels for solo travelers include:
1. **The Hoxton, Paris** – Chic interiors and a vibrant atmosphere.
2. **Mama Shelter, Istanbul** – Unique design with a lively social scene.
3. **The Standard, High Line, New York** – Modern design with stunning views and a rooftop bar.
4. **Hotel Amour, Paris** – Stylish and intimate, perfect for solo exploration.
5. **25hours Hotel Bikini Berlin** – Eclectic design and a communal vibe.
6. **The Line Hotel, Los Angeles** – Contemporary design with a focus on local culture.
